How Do You Overcome Ill Effects Of Social Media On Relationships?

Social media has overshadowed every part of our lives. Whether it is business, relations, or even politics, it leaves an impact everywhere. Now whether you scroll through your feed everyday or do it occasionally, you do carry an online identity. We know how taxing it is to manage our individual online presence being responsible for every aspect of our lives that we share on social media. 

While social media can be a great tool to connect with this fast-evolving world, it can be harmful to our relationships. No matter how hard we try to be positive always, our human minds are wired to think in a negative way first. As we start adapting to the negativity around, we feel the first impact on our relationships. When life makes our overwhelm, we switch on our phones and get carried away by the content created. It becomes a dopamine to fix our pain. 

Very soon, we start comparing our real life with the reel life shown there and that’s where the problems start. And this is how social media enters your life, your personal space with your spouse only to ruin it further. 

If you do not want social media to mess up your life, it is important to maintain boundaries. For example, you can ensure that you do not scroll through your feed when your partner is around. Instead of wasting time on social media, you should take efforts and spend some good time with your partner.
